Would a .44cal Jukar kentucky take a .433" patched round ball?
I would try a .430 for a patched round ball.
Talked to a couple of old customers that have these pistols, both use .430 with no issues.
 
I bought a Pedersoli LePage on an auction, but haven't received it yet. It is in .44, and Pedersoli states it takes a .435 RB, but I am going to try the .433's since they are more readily available. Hopefully I can make up for the difference with the patch. I just ordered 300 of the Hornady's, so they better shoot good.
 
The h & a underhammer pistols use a .433" ball and a Jukar I had took a .440". A .433" would be a safe bet with the right patching.
 
My old H&A Heritage model rifle was recommended for use with a .433" to .435" ball. All other .45s I've owned did well with either a .440" or .445" ball.
 
As Hanshi stated,. most H&A underhammers had a slightly undersize bore dia. However all were very accurate some even with .440. As always experiments with each individual rifle may vary.....Mossie
 
My CVA Prospector recommends a .433 ball with .012 patch. I have both but have not tried them yet. I get the balls from Deer Creek in a nice blister pack of 25 each. No banging together..
